Intel Core Ultra 5 135HL or Intel Core i5-14600K -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The Intel Core Ultra 5 135HL has 14 cores with 18 threads and clocks with a maximum frequency of 4.60 GHz. Up to 96 GB of memory is supported in 2 memory channels. The Intel Core Ultra 5 135HL was released in Q2/2024.

The Intel Core i5-14600K has 14 cores with 20 threads and clocks with a maximum frequency of 5.30 GHz. The CPU supports up to 192 GB of memory in 2 memory channels. The Intel Core i5-14600K was released in Q4/2023.

CPU Cores and Base Frequency

The Intel Core Ultra 5 135HL is a 14 core processor with a clock frequency of 1.70 GHz (4.60 GHz). The Intel Core i5-14600K has 14 CPU cores with a clock frequency of 3.50 GHz (5.30 GHz).

Memory & PCIe

The Intel Core Ultra 5 135HL supports a maximum of 96 GB of memory in 2 memory channels. The Intel Core i5-14600K can connect up to 192 GB of memory in 2 memory channels.

Thermal Management

The TDP (Thermal Design Power) of a processor specifies the required cooling solution. The Intel Core Ultra 5 135HL has a TDP of 45 W, that of the Intel Core i5-14600K is 125 W.
